Meetings and Communications
Meeting Times and Places
- The primary meeting location of AcadiaGeeks is in the IRC channel hosted on Slack in #acadiageeks. Attendance is expected, but not mandatory.
- Occasional ad-hoc, in-person meetings may be arranged by members as needed
- Annually, as many members as possible attempt to meet up for the GeekBrau beer tasting party. This is typically held around the Christmas season, but can be rescheduled as required.
